Adrenal-Gonadal Interaction

Meaning

Adrenal-gonadal interaction refers to the intricate physiological relationship and reciprocal influence between the adrenal glands and the gonads, specifically the ovaries in females and testes in males. This dynamic interplay involves shared steroidogenic pathways, precursor hormone synthesis, and feedback mechanisms that collectively regulate various aspects of human physiology, including reproduction, metabolism, and stress response.
